Transaction 262462ecd3491e5d6db685e7533af18a7cb2158f10f1d8bcd9450933126d0a97
4 Input
1 Outputs
- 262462ecd3491e5d6db685e7533af18a7cb2158f10f1d8bcd9450933126d0a97:0
value 12024
address 33CrWJJ6iVWMtGHpWC8UusieY5NAenGdU5